Обычно:
Проверьте версию CUDA:
cat /usr/local/cuda/version.txt
и версию cuDNN:
grep CUDNN_MAJOR -A 2 /usr/local/cuda/include/cudnn.h
и установите комбинацию, как показано ниже на изображениях или здесь .
Следующие изображения и ссылка предоставляют обзор официально поддерживаемых / протестированных комбинаций CUDA и TensorFlow в Linux, macOS и Windows:
Незначительные конфигурации:
Поскольку приведенные ниже спецификации в некоторых случаях могут быть слишком широкими, вот одна конкретная конфигурация, которая работает:
tensorflow-gpu==1.12.0
cuda==9.0
cuDNN==7.1.4
Соответствующий cudnn можно загрузить здесь .
(цифры обновлены 29 июня,2019)
Linux GPU
Linux
macOS GPU
macOS
(цифра обновлена 31 мая 2018 г.)
Ветервл.